How to Clean Wheels, Tires, Wheel Wells, and Exhaust Tips
Learn the finish before you spray it. Cool the assembly, keep wheel tools separate, lift wheel and tire soil in controlled stages, and finish with no slippery dressing and no chemical stains.

Before you start
Look before you spray: finish type, curb damage, corrosion, loose weights and caps, tire condition, hot brakes, carbon-ceramic components, aftermarket hardware, and what the exhaust is made of.
Tools and materials
- dedicated wheel and tire brushes
- lug/recess brush
- wheel-well tools
- low-pressure rinse and drying tools
- finish-compatible wheel cleaner
- tire cleaner if needed
- PPE
- label-approved dressing optional
Steps
Do the work in order.
-
Step 1 Cool and inspect
Confirm the components are cool, identify the wheel and exhaust finishes, photograph existing damage, and flag unsafe tires, loose parts, or sensitive brakes.
-
Step 2 Pre-rinse the corner
Use controlled water to carry loose grit off the well, tire, face, barrel, and exhaust without driving water into sensitive areas.
-
Step 3 Clean tire and wheel well
Apply compatible products the way the label says, agitate with dedicated tools, keep dwell on a short leash, and rinse before residue dries.
-
Step 4 Clean wheel face and barrel
Work top to bottom with a finish-safe cleaner and separate soft tools for the face, lug recesses, spokes, and as much barrel as you can reach.
-
Step 5 Clean exhaust tips carefully
Confirm the material is cool and check for coating. Start with the least aggressive compatible cleaner on soft media, and don’t promise away permanent etching or corrosion.
-
Step 6 Rinse and inspect
Rinse every recess, brake-safe area, tire, and adjacent panel. If something needs another pass, repeat only that targeted, compatible step.
-
Step 7 Dry and dress safely
Dry with wheel-only tools. If dressing is approved, lay a thin compatible coat on the clean sidewall only and wipe off the excess.

How it works
A wheel area throws everything at you at once: hot brakes, mixed materials, iron-rich dust, road film, rubber, grease, and sharp edges. Knowing the finish, and keeping dwell short and controlled, matters far more than reaching for the strongest chemical on the shelf.
Terms used in this guide
- Wheel finishThe exposed coating or material you’re actually touching — clear-coated paint, powder coat, bare polished metal, matte coating, or a plated surface.
- BloomingThe brown film that appears as antiozonants — protective compounds inside the rubber — migrate to a tire’s surface. Cleaning lifts it off as brown runoff, and some brown in the rinse is normal, not a reason for endless scrubbing.
Common mistakes
- Cleaning wheels while they’re hot.
- Assuming every shiny wheel is chrome.
- One stiff brush for every finish.
- Letting cleaner dry down in the lug holes.
- Laying dressing on thick and glossy.
- Polishing a coated exhaust like it’s bare metal.
Troubleshooting
- Brake dust remains embeddedConfirm the finish first, then reach for a label-approved iron or fallout process with controlled agitation — not harder scrubbing.
- Tire stays brown after dryingCheck product compatibility and the sidewall’s condition, run a controlled repeat cleaning, and accept that aging and blooming have permanent limits.
- A wheel finish is unknownGo with the least aggressive pH-appropriate method after a test spot — or stop and get manufacturer or owner information first.

What good looks like
- The finish was identified — or treated gently as an unknown.
- Tools never migrated from wheels to paint.
- Lug recesses and barrels got a real rinse.
- Tire dressing is even, with nothing left to sling.
- No product touched tread or brakes.
- Existing corrosion is documented, not hidden.

Are acid wheel cleaners unsafe?
They can damage incompatible finishes and they demand strict controls. Use one only when the manufacturer permits that exact finish and condition, and the trained process, PPE, dwell, and rinse are all in place.
Why do tires turn brown?
Soil, old dressing, rubber additives, aging, and oxidation can all play a part. Clean safely, then explain permanent material condition instead of scrubbing without end.
Can wheel dressing go on wet tires?
Follow the product label. Most dressings look better and sling less on clean, appropriately dry sidewalls with the excess wiped away.
